Hello Vintage drum center

Im looking for a date.

I recently acquired 2 Ludwig Toms 1-12x8 & 1- 14x10

both have the Ludwig Standard type lugs not the classic type lugs

with black & white Ludwig parallelagram badge with the serial

#'s

6191753 & 6191754 and made in the USA.The shells are thin and made of maple with clear wood finish inside no reinforcement rings and a black gloss exterior wrap.

My question to anyone out there is do you have any idea as to when these toms might have been made?

Thank you your response is greatly appreciated.
